Chung Hok House is a mid-terrace house in Liverpool (L1 7BX). It has a recorded floor area of 42 m² (around 452 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1991-1995. The latest certificate (July 2021) returns a B (score 81), comfortably above the UK average. The rating has held steady at B across 2 certificates since March 2011.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good. At 42 m² this is the 18th smallest of 39 units on EPC record in Chung Hok House, where floor areas span 30–90 m². The building's EPC ratings span C to B, with this unit at the top.
On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ode.

No sales recorded with HM Land Registry
That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
